mysql和java作业
时间: 2023-05-09 13:00:24 浏览: 102
MySQL是一种强大的关系型数据库管理系统,能够高效地处理大量数据。Java是一种流行的编程语言,被广泛应用于Web开发、移动应用、桌面应用等领域。
在MySQL和Java作业中,我们通常需要使用Java语言来连接MySQL数据库,并通过Java代码来对数据库进行增删改查操作。由于MySQL数据库提供了丰富的API和工具,可以方便地进行开发和维护。
在Java开发中,使用JDBC API来连接MySQL数据库是比较常见的做法。JDBC提供了一组接口,用于编写Java程序来访问和操作数据库。我们可以使用JDBC API来连接MySQL数据库、执行SQL语句、获取结果集等操作。
此外,在MySQL和Java作业中,我们还需要熟练掌握SQL语言的基本语法。SQL是结构化查询语言的缩写,是一种通用的数据库查询语言,用于在关系型数据库中进行增删改查操作。
总之,MySQL和Java作业需要我们掌握MySQL数据库的基本操作和Java语言的基本开发技术,以及熟练使用JDBC API和SQL语言,才能高效地完成作业并达到预期的效果。
相关问题
java大作业学生管理系统mysql
基于引用内容,以下是一个基于Java、Servlet和MySQL的学生信息管理系统的大作业示例:
```java
import java.sql.*;
import javax.servlet.*;
import javax.servlet.http.*;
public class StudentManagementSystem extends HttpServlet {
public void doGet(HttpServletRequest request, HttpServletResponse response) {
try {
// 连接到MySQL数据库
String url = "jdbc:mysql://localhost:3306/student_db";
String username = "root";
String password = "password";
Connection conn = DriverManager.getConnection(url, username, password);
// 执行SQL查询语句
Statement stmt = conn.createStatement();
String sql = "SELECT * FROM students";
ResultSet rs = stmt.executeQuery(sql);
// 输出查询结果
while (rs.next()) {
int id = rs.getInt("id");
String name = rs.getString("name");
int age = rs.getInt("age");
String major = rs.getString("major");
System.out.println("ID: " + id + ", Name: " + name + ", Age: " + age + ", Major: " + major);
}
// 关闭数据库连接
rs.close();
stmt.close();
conn.close();
} catch (Exception e) {
e.printStackTrace();
}
}
}
```
这个示例代码演示了如何使用Java、Servlet和MySQL来创建一个学生信息管理系统。它连接到MySQL数据库,执行一个查询语句,并输出查询结果。你可以根据自己的需求进行修改和扩展。
java swing+mysql 学生管理系统小组作业
Java Swing MySQL学生管理系统是一个由小组合作完成的作业项目。该系统旨在帮助学校或教育机构更有效地管理学生信息,包括个人资料、学习成绩、考勤记录等。
在这个系统中,Java被用来实现前端界面的设计和用户交互功能,使用Swing库可以创建出美观、功能丰富的图形用户界面。而MySQL则被用来构建后端的数据库,存储和管理学生的各种信息和数据。
在小组合作中,每个成员都需要承担不同的职责和任务。可能有的成员负责界面设计和布局,有的成员负责编写业务逻辑和数据处理的代码,还有的成员负责数据库设计和管理。通过合理分工和密切合作,小组成员可以充分发挥各自的优势,共同完成这个学生管理系统的开发工作。
除了技术的实现,团队合作和沟通也是非常重要的。小组成员需要定期进行会议讨论进展和遇到的问题,及时沟通和协调各项工作。而且需要不断地进行代码合并和测试,确保整个系统的功能和性能都能够符合预期。
总的来说,通过合作完成Java Swing MySQL学生管理系统的小组作业,可以帮助学生了解团队合作的重要性,并提升他们的编程能力和项目管理能力。同时也可以锻炼学生的沟通和解决问题的能力,为他们未来的职业发展打下坚实的基础。